Share via


ButtonBase.OnMouseLeftButtonUp(MouseButtonEventArgs) Metode

Definisi

Menyediakan penanganan kelas untuk peristiwa yang dirutekan MouseLeftButtonUp yang terjadi ketika tombol mouse kiri dilepaskan saat penunjuk mouse berada di atas kontrol ini.

protected:
 override void OnMouseLeftButtonUp(System::Windows::Input::MouseButtonEventArgs ^ e);
protected override void OnMouseLeftButtonUp (System.Windows.Input.MouseButtonEventArgs e);
override this.OnMouseLeftButtonUp : System.Windows.Input.MouseButtonEventArgs -> unit
Protected Overrides Sub OnMouseLeftButtonUp (e As MouseButtonEventArgs)

Parameter

e
MouseButtonEventArgs

Data peristiwa.

Keterangan

Implementasi ini menandai peristiwa sebagai ditangani MouseLeftButtonUp dengan mengatur Handled properti data peristiwa ke true kapan ClickMode tidak diatur ke Hover. Untuk menanggapi MouseLeftButtonUp peristiwa, lampirkan penanganan aktivitas ke PreviewMouseLeftButtonUp acara, atau panggil AddHandler(RoutedEvent, Delegate, Boolean) dengan handledEventsToo diatur ke true.

Ketika ClickMode diatur ke Release adalah IsPressedtrue, metode ini meningkatkan Click peristiwa.

Catatan Bagi Inheritor

Jika Anda mengambil alih OnMouseLeftButtonUp(MouseButtonEventArgs), selalu panggil implementasi dasar dalam implementasi Anda OnMouseLeftButtonUp(MouseButtonEventArgs) . Kegagalan untuk memanggil implementasi dasar mencegah kelas dasar menangani peristiwa dengan handler kelas, yang mungkin mengubah perilaku run-time kelas akhir. Anda dapat memanggil implementasi dasar baik sebelum atau sesudah penanganan khusus Anda, tergantung pada kebutuhan Anda.

Berlaku untuk